Swiss turning, also commonly known as Swiss screw machining, differs from more traditional lathe operations. Where a standard lathe holds the workpiece at one or both ends and applies the tool to cut away material, a Swiss turning machine uses a guide bushing to guide the mounted cutting tools. The spinning workpiece emerges or recedes from the guide bushing as needed, allowing cutting tools to perform highly precise cuts with minimal force. Swiss machines can also perform multiple operations simultaneously for more cost-effective machining.

Swiss turning is an ideal process for high-volume production of extraordinarily complex small parts. The additional support provided by the guide bushing mitigates vibration that may interfere with precise cuts on standard lathes. CNC Swiss turning machines are fully automated for continuous operation and can accommodate high production volumes. 

At Pacific Precision, our Swiss machining capabilities include:

  • Repeatable tolerances within ± .0002”
  • Lights Out production
  • Low-to-high production volumes
  • Short lead times due to the ability to run unattended
